English: Young Italian peasant girl wearing a tambourine on her head (1838), by Albert Küchler
Date 1838
date QS:P571,+1838-00-00T00:00:00Z/9
Medium Graphite on paper
Dimensions 22.5 x 14.5 cm (8 7/8 x 5 3/4 in.)
Notes The present drawing is preparatory for the little girl in the artist's painting A Young Abbot Recites his Lesson to his Sister today in the museum Thorvaldsen, Copenhaguen. The painting was executed in 1838 and our drawing was likely made just prior to the painting. The inscription Dominica on the verso may be the name of the model. Civitella likely refers to where the drawing was executed. (Taken from the site)
